With the commitment of Shaun Williams last week, speculation has begun on who will or will not be there in order to open a scholarship up. Speculation increased because, right now, Amaad Wainright and Mawdo Sallah are not on campus yet.
A source tells me that Mawdo will arrive soon and begin international student orientation, so he will be on campus this fall.
I also just spoke to Amaad Wainright, who tells me he will arrive to campus on August 19, two days before classes begin.
So those two will be on campus this fall. Does that mean that they are not the players who may leave and open a scholarship? No, because they could very easily leave as quickly as they arrive. But this does confirm that everyone will arrive to campus at some point.
It will definitely be a departure, rather than a, "never showed up," when it comes to opening Williams' scholarship.
